Introduction to Living Container Houses

Living container houses are residential structures built using standard shipping containers as the primary building material. These containers, originally designed for transporting goods, are converted into habitable spaces through a series of modifications, including insulation, electricity, plumbing, and finishing work. The concept of living container houses emerged as an innovative solution to the growing demand for sustainable and cost-effective housing. Their increasing popularity can be attributed to their numerous advantages, making them a popular choice for both individuals and developers.
Traditional residential construction often involves extensive site preparation, long construction periods, and higher environmental impacts. Container houses offer a faster, more adaptable, and eco-friendly alternative. The modular design of these structures allows for easy transport and relocation, while their robust steel construction ensures long-term durability.

What Are Living Container Houses?

Living container houses are unique in their structure and construction process. They are typically composed of one or more shipping containers stacked together, modified to create the desired living space. Key features include:
- Modular Design: Containers can be easily transported and relocated, making them highly adaptable to various projects.
- Durability: Shipping containers are constructed from robust steel, ensuring long-term durability and resistance to weather.
- Environmental Impact: These houses are considered eco-friendly due to their minimal waste, rapid construction time, and resource-efficient manufacturing processes.
Living container houses offer a stark contrast to traditional construction methods, which often involve extensive site preparation, long construction periods, and higher environmental impacts. For instance, a container house could be built in just a few months, whereas traditional homes might take a year or more to complete.


The Benefits and Drawbacks of Living Container Houses

Benefits:
- Environmental Advantages: Living container houses significantly reduce the carbon footprint associated with new construction. The use of recycled materials and the reduced need for site preparation and demolition make them an environmentally friendly option.
- Cost and Time Efficiency: The modular nature of container homes allows for faster construction times and lower labor costs. They can be erected in a fraction of the time required for traditional construction methods. For example, a typical container home can be built in about 90 days, whereas a traditional home might take 12 to 18 months.
Drawbacks:
- Structural Integrity: Ensuring that stacked containers remain stable and secure can be challenging. Structural reinforcement and careful design are crucial to achieving safety and durability. For instance, container homes in California must meet specific seismic requirements to ensure they can withstand earthquakes.
- Zoning Laws: Regulations vary widely by location, and some municipalities may have strict guidelines or prohibitions on container homes. In New York City, for example, there are extensive zoning restrictions that must be adhered to.


Legal and Regulatory Framework for Living Container Houses

Construction of living container houses is subject to various legal and regulatory requirements. These vary significantly by region, making it essential to understand the local laws and regulations before proceeding with a project. Common requirements include:
- Permits and Approvals: Local building permits and certifications are necessary to ensure the house complies with safety and zoning regulations. In Miami, for example, developers must obtain building permits from the local authority to ensure compliance.
- Building Codes: Compliance with local building codes, including structural integrity, fire safety, and electrical requirements, is mandatory. This ensures that container homes meet the same safety standards as traditional homes. For instance, builders in Los Angeles must adhere to strict building codes to ensure the structural integrity of container homes.
